桉树制浆造纸性能的研究(第二报)——雷州半岛四种桉树浆的漂白试验
引用本文:廖品玉 ,洪启清 ,张大同.桉树制浆造纸性能的研究(第二报)——雷州半岛四种桉树浆的漂白试验[J].南京林业大学学报(自然科学版),1980,23(3):57.
作者姓名:廖品玉  洪启清  张大同
摘    要:<正>对柠檬桉烧碱—蒽醌浆(AP+AQ)和硫酸盐浆(KP)进行了H单段,H—H两段,C—E—H三段以及C—E—H—D四段漂白试验。对雷林一号桉、草律桉、窿缘桉硫酸盐浆还做了H单段漂白性能的对比试验。结果表明:在用氯量7%、浆浓6%,温度40℃、时间3小时的H单段漂白条件下,柠檬桉(AP+AQ)和柠檬桉(KP)的白度均可达70度以上。采用C—E—H—D四段漂,用氯量为6%,柠檬桉(AP+AQ)的白度超过80度,D.P.在800以上。四种桉树中,雷林一号桉的漂白性能最好,窿缘桉最难漂白,草律桉与柠檬桉的漂白性能相近。柠檬桉、草律桉、雷林一号桉制得的漂白浆,物理强度甚好,裂断长6060—8050米,耐折度59—413次,可以用来生产一般文化用纸,也可考虑用来生产某些高级纸张。


STUDIES ON PULPING AND PAPERMAKING PROPERTIES OF EUCALYPTUS WOODSII. Bleaching Experiments on Four Species of Eucalyptus in Leizhou Peninsula
Abstract:Bleaching experiments on soda-anthraquinone (AP + AQ) and kraft pulps (KP) of E. citriodora have been carried out in the H, H-H, C-E-H, and C-E-H-D sequences. Bleaching properties of kraft pulps of E. Leizhou No.l, E. tsaaulyuh No.2. and E. exserta in the H process have also been tested. Results indicated E. citriodora (AP + AQ) and E. citriodora (KP) both reached a brightness of over 70% (G. E.) , when an active chlorine of 7% and a pulp consistency of 6% were employed under a temperature of 40℃ for three hours in the H sequence. The brightness of E. citriodora (AP +AQ) reached over 80% (G. E.) and D. P. above 800 when chlorine of 7% was used in the C-E-H-D sequence. Of the four species of eucalyptus, the bleaching property of E.Leizhou No.l was the best, and E. exserta was found most difficult to bleach. The bleaching property of E. tsaaulyuh No.2 was similar to that of E. citrodora. Physical strengths of the bleached pulps of E. citriodora, E. tsaaulyuh No.2 and Leizhou No.l turned up to be quite good, with a breaking length of 6060-8050M, and a folding strength of 59-413. All these pulps can be used to produce paper for printing purposes or even some finer paper.
